Sarkozy Returns Home After Being Informed On His Imprisonment - Paris

Sarkozy Returns Home After Being Informed On His Imprisonment - Paris

French former president Nicolas Sarkozy exits a vehicle as he returns to his home in Paris, France on October 13, 2025, following his meeting with prosecutors to be informed of the start of his jail sentence, after a court sentenced him last month to five years behind bars for criminal conspiracy. Sarkozy, France's leader from 2007 to 2012, was convicted in late September over a scheme for late Libyan dictator Moamer Kadhafi to fund his 2007 presidential run. Strategic Committee of Les Republicains - Paris

Strategic Committee of Les Republicains - Paris

France's outgoing Minister in charge of Transports Philippe Tabarot leaves headquarters of Les Republicains party after a meeting, in Paris, on October 6, 2025. France's President Emmanuel Macron on October 6, 2025 accepted Prime Minister Sebastien Lecornu's resignation, the presidency said, plunging the European nation further into political deadlock. Macron named Lecornu last month to the post, but the largely unchanged cabinet lineup he unveiled late October 5, 2025 was met with fierce criticism across the political spectrum. First Day Of The Holy Month Of Ramadan - Bangladesh

First Day Of The Holy Month Of Ramadan - Bangladesh

Bangladeshi Muslims buy food for breaking their fast during the first day of the fasting month of Ramadan at a traditional food market at Chalk bazar, in Dhaka, Bangladesh, 12 March 2024. The Muslims' holy month of Ramadan is the ninth month in the Islamic calendar, and it is believed that the revelation of the first verse in the Koran was during its last 10 nights. It is also a time for socializing, mainly in the evening after breaking the fast, and a shift of all activities to late in the day in most countries. Photo by Habibur Rahman/ABACAPRESS.COM

New building of museum at Shang Dynasty capital site to open this month

STORY: New building of museum at Shang Dynasty capital site to open this month SHOOTING TIME: Feb. 22, 2024 DATELINE: Feb. 23, 2024 LENGTH: 00:00:27 LOCATION: ANYANG, China CATEGORY: CULTURE SHOTLIST: 1. various of cultural relics of the Yinxu Museum STORYLINE: The new building of the Yinxu Museum at the Yin Ruins, the site of the last capital of the Shang Dynasty (1600 B.C.-1046 B.C.), will open to the public on Feb. 26. The announcement was made at a press conference held by the National Cultural Heritage Administration on Monday in Beijing. The museum, located in the city of Anyang in central China's Henan Province, will showcase nearly 4,000 items or sets of cultural relics, including bronzeware, pottery, jade objects, and oracle bones. The exhibition features a vast quantity and diverse range of cultural artifacts, with over three-quarters of the relics making their debut appearances. Gender of Russia's first-ever newborn panda cub revealed

STORY: Gender of Russia's first-ever newborn panda cub revealed DATELINE: Sept. 26, 2023 LENGTH: 00:01:12 LOCATION: Moscow CATEGORY: ENVIRONMENT SHOTLIST: 1. various of the newly born panda cub STORYLINE: The first-ever giant panda cub that was born at the Moscow Zoo last month is a female, the Moscow Zoo confirmed Sunday. The cub was born late last month to a young pair of giant pandas, Ruyi (male) and Dingding (female), which arrived in Moscow in April 2019 from China's southwestern province of Sichuan. The baby panda has recently turned one month, and zoologists have carried out tests confirming that the cub is female. The cub is being inspected by experts in a special incubator, where the temperature and humidity are comfortable for it. The incubator has everything necessary for the cub including diapers, blankets and pillows with cassia seeds (Chinese cinnamon). C919 jetliner arrives in south China's tropical island

STORY: C919 jetliner arrives in south China's tropical island DATELINE: Jan. 3, 2023 LENGTH: 00:00:48 LOCATION: HAIKOU, China CATEGORY: TECHNOLOGY SHOTLIST: 1. various of the plane STORYLINE: China's C919 large passenger jet landed at an airport in Haikou on Monday, as a part of its 100-hour aircraft validation flight process. The C919 is China's first homegrown large jetliner. The first such aircraft was delivered to China Eastern Airlines last month. The C919 started its airline validation flight in late December. The testing process will comprehensively verify the reliability of the C919 with commercial operation in mind -- with the aim of ensuring its safety and efficiency. The validation flight will last until mid-February and the aircraft is expected to be put into commercial operation by China Eastern Airlines in the spring of this year. Masked wrestler takes seat in Iwate assembly

Masked wrestler takes seat in Iwate assembly

MORIOKA, Japan - Professional wrestler ''the Great Sasuke'' has a lawmaker's badge pinned to his lapel before attending the Iwate prefectural assembly May 6 for the first time since being elected to the assembly late last month. The 33-year-old wrestler, whose real name is Masanori Murakawa, is wearing a modified mask with the prefectural emblem emblazoned on it, instead of the colorful mask he usually wears in the ring, to show respect for the assembly.

Kuwait witnesses rising demand for dishdasha during Ramadan

STORY: Kuwait witnesses rising demand for dishdasha during Ramadan DATELINE: April 25, 2022 LENGTH: 00:01:05 LOCATION: Kuwait City CATEGORY: SOCIETY SHOTLIST: 1. various of tailor shops STORYLINE: Kuwait witnessed high demand for dishdasha during the past several days of the holy month of Ramadan. As a traditional dress, dishdasha is a long-sleeved garment worn by Muslim men in the Gulf region. During this period of time, many Kuwaitis race to buy or make dishdashas for the celebration of the upcoming Eid Al-Fitr which marks the end of Ramadan. Men's tailor shops in Kuwait witness very crowded days before the Eid festival and some shop owners have refused to receive more customers since the beginning of the last ten days of Ramadan, under the pretext of lack of time. Al-Khayyat Imtiaz Ihsan, an owner of a tailor shop, explained that the prices of making dishdasha are fixed, but some customers come late.
